| Scientists identified distinct subsets of human long-term-HSCs that responded differently to regeneration-mediated stress: an immune checkpoint ligand CD112lo subset that exhibited a transient engraftment restraint before contributing to hematopoietic reconstitution and a primed CD112hi subset that responded rapidly. [Nature Immunology] |

| Researchers showed that nicotinamide riboside, a form of vitamin B3, restored youthful metabolic capacity by modifying mitochondrial function in multiple ways. [Nature Communications] |

| The authors characterized a group of natural sesquiterpene lactones, previously shown to suppress MYB activity, for their potential to decrease AML cell proliferation. [Oncogene] |

| Scientists investigated thirty-four plasmablastic lymphoma using an integrated approach, including fluorescence in situ hybridization, targeted sequencing of 94 B-cell lymphoma related genes, and copy-number arrays. [Haematologica] |

| Researchers investigated whether interleukin 4 (IL4) had antileukemic activity via immune-mediated mechanisms in an in vivo murine model of acute myeloid leukemia driven by the MLL–AF9 fusion gene. [Haematologica] |

| The authors describe a powerful seven day HSC hibernation culture system that maintained HSCs as single cells in the absence of a physical niche. [Stem Cell Reports] |

| Researchers found the antimalarial artesunate significantly inhibited ubiquitin-specific protease 7 (USP7)/BCR-ABL interaction, thereby promoting BCR-ABL degradation and inducing chronic myelogenous leukemia cell death. [Cell Death & Disease] |

| Scientists described a non-genotoxic conditioning protocol using an immunotoxin targeting CD117 to achieve endogenous HSC depletion and a cocktail of monoclonal antibodies to provide transient immune suppression against the transgene product in a murine hemophilia A gene therapy model. [Molecular Therapy-Methods & Clinical Development] |

| Human HSCs were differentiated into megakaryocytes, enabling the transfection of miR-204-5p and the recovery of subsequent platelet-like structures. [Thrombosis and Haemostasis] |

| Scientists performed multipronged genomic analyses in longitudinally collected specimens from 60 isocitrate dehydrogenase 1 (IDH1)- or IDH2-mutant AML patients treated with the inhibitors. [Nature Communications] |

| The authors performed deep sequencing of TP53 using baseline samples collected from 51 TP53 aberrant patients treated with ibrutinib in a Phase II study. [Clinical Cancer Research] |

| Investigators analyzed expression of immune checkpoint molecules and infiltration of immune cells in nodal samples, and peripheral blood T-cell diversity in 33 chronic lymphocytic leukemia and 37 Richter syndrome patients. [Blood Cancer Journal] |
